Description

Nestled in the charming town of Chesaning, this Irish pub offers a warm atmosphere perfect for holiday gatherings. Patrons rave about the delicious Reuben sandwiches and the swift service from some bartenders, while others express frustration over inconsistent attentiveness. Though the establishment is cozy and inviting, with a jukebox and ample parking, the experience can be marred by occasional rudeness or delays in service, particularly during busy times. Despite these drawbacks, many guests appreciate the owners' personal touch and the welcoming vibe, making it a recommended stop when traveling through this delightful town.
